# 🎉 Automatic Seed Generation - Zero Manual Implementation

The `add_compressible_instructions_enhanced` macro now supports **completely automatic** seed generation for both PDA accounts and CToken accounts. **NO MORE MANUAL IMPLEMENTATION NEEDED!**

## ✅ **The New Developer Experience**

### **Before (Manual Hell):** 100+ lines of boilerplate

```rust
// Manual PDA seed functions
pub fn get_user_record_seeds(user: &Pubkey) -> (Vec<Vec<u8>>, Pubkey) { /* 10 lines */ }
pub fn get_game_session_seeds(session_id: u64) -> (Vec<Vec<u8>>, Pubkey) { /* 10 lines */ }
pub fn get_placeholder_record_seeds(placeholder_id: u64) -> (Vec<Vec<u8>>, Pubkey) { /* 10 lines */ }

// Manual CToken seed function
pub fn get_ctoken_signer_seeds(user: &Pubkey, mint: &Pubkey) -> (Vec<Vec<u8>>, Pubkey) { /* 15 lines */ }

// Manual CTokenSeedProvider trait implementation
impl ctoken_seed_system::CTokenSeedProvider for CTokenAccountVariant { /* 30+ lines */ }
```

### **After (Pure Magic):** 1 macro call

```rust
#[add_compressible_instructions_enhanced(
UserRecord = ("user_record", data.owner),
GameSession = ("game_session", data.session_id.to_le_bytes()),
PlaceholderRecord = ("placeholder_record", data.placeholder_id.to_le_bytes()),
CTokenSigner = ("ctoken_signer", ctx.fee_payer, ctx.mint)
)]
#[program]
pub mod my_program {
// Your instructions - zero seed boilerplate! 🎉
}
```

## 🔥 **Syntax Guide**

### **PDA Account Seeds**

For PDA accounts, use `data.field_name` to access account data:

```rust
UserRecord = ("user_record", data.owner),
GameSession = ("game_session", data.session_id.to_le_bytes()),
CustomAccount = ("custom", data.custom_field, data.another_field.to_le_bytes())
```

### **CToken Account Seeds**

For CToken accounts, use `ctx.field_name` to access context:

```rust
CTokenSigner = ("ctoken_signer", ctx.fee_payer, ctx.mint),
UserVault = ("user_vault", ctx.owner, ctx.mint),
CustomTokenAccount = ("custom_token", ctx.accounts.custom_field, ctx.mint)
```

### **Supported Expressions**

The macro supports any valid Rust expression:

```rust
// String literals
"user_record"

// Data field access (for PDAs)
data.owner // Pubkey field
data.session_id.to_le_bytes() // u64 to bytes
data.custom_field // Any field

// Context field access (for CTokens)
ctx.fee_payer // Standard context
ctx.mint // Standard context
ctx.owner // Standard context
ctx.accounts.user // Instruction account access

// Complex expressions
some_id.to_be_bytes()
custom_calculation()
```
